Abstract
In additive color mixture, n (≥2 ) colors are given then the color mixture result is determined uniquely. On the other hand, in subtractive color mixture, the result is not unique which are not clarified also in today. In No.I article of the series, we first derived theorems related to the upper and lower bounds of the subtractive color mixture. Second, using these theorems, theorems related to the centroid of the possible range of a stimulus value are derived. In this article, it is shown that the centroid of resultant tristimulus values is represented approximately in the multiplication form between component tristimulus values. This multiplication corresponds to the addition in additive color mixture and has a significant meaning in the color mixture systematization.
